Since time immemorial, the privilege of bearing a coat of arms has been granted to specific individuals who bear the surname Koogler, without this honor being automatically extended to all who share that surname. The right to use a particular coat of arms is passed down from generation to generation, following the rules and customs of heraldry. Therefore, not all individuals who share the surname Koogler possess the heraldic right to use the coat of arms associated with their ancestors.
Only surnames that have been duly documented and registered by a heraldic authority, and for which a coat of arms has been designed and conferred, will have an officially recognized heraldry. The connection between the heraldic shield and Koogler is deep and rich in nuances. Initially, coats of arms were awarded to particular individuals, not to an entire lineage, and were linked to the person who had received them for their exploits, prowess in battle, or social status. With the passage of time, the emblem of Koogler acquired a hereditary character, becoming a recognizable badge of the family lineage, thus establishing an indissoluble link with the surname Koogler.
Legacy: Although the heraldic emblem may be associated with Koogler, it is relevant to remember that historically they were granted to individuals. This implies that not all people with the surname Koogler have hereditary right to the coat of arms linked to Koogler, especially if they cannot prove direct descent from the original bearer of the coat of arms. Likewise, it is possible that there are different shields for the surname Koogler, since they could have been granted to individuals from different families but with the same surname Koogler.
Modifications: Within a family with the surname Koogler, it is common to find different modifications in the heraldic shield that serve to distinguish between different family branches, generations or individual titles.
